My lo is 5 weeks old tomorrow and had started taking 5oz of milk every 3 hours but now she has started only takin 4 and even then she's spitting most of it out. I kinda feel she should maybe takin more than this by now as she was taking 3.5 at birth. How much does ur lo take and how often? Ive tried speaking to my hv about it but id be better talking to brick wall :cry:
 
Hannah's almost 4 months and only takes 4-5 ounces every 4 hours. She could have hit a growth spurt during the time she was taking more formula.
 
How much does weigh? My HV told me to halve their weight and that will tell you how much they should be having at a feed. I was worried cos Ollie has been having 4oz the past few days every 3-4 hours and he's suddenly dropped to 2-3oz. My HV said as his weight is 6lb 12oz then he should be having about 3-3.5oz so not to worry that he's dropped x
 
Jasmine has 6-7oz but will only take 3 bottles a day, she has been weaned though, when Jasmine was around 6months she would only take around 4-5oz so your LO should be fine x

They do say that LO's are supposed to take 2.5 times their weight (average) in feeds per day. But Hannah's never taken that much, she's always eaten lower than what the guidelines say she is supposed to :shrug: Certainly hasn't hurt her weight gain though :lol:
 
My lo was weighed yest at 5+1 weeks and weighs 10lb 7oz (weighed 6lb 15oz at birth), hv at clinic told me not to worry about the lack of feeding as lo is puttin on weight at a steady pace but still feel she should be taking more, now shes falling asleep after only 2oz and its a real struggle to get her to take somemore :(
 
Babies go through times like that, I know it can be worrying but she's gaining weight and that's what matters.

Yeah my HV said that too, you can work it out by either working out 2.5 times their body weight and that gives you the amount they should have in 24 hours or halving their body weight to get the amount of milk they should be having at each feed. I'm the same as you Vicki, Ollie doesn't keep with the guidelines but is gaining fine so I'm not worrying x
